DUNLAVY county chairman every victory for better things costs it is estimated that the nine weeks strike of the cloak makers in new york now ended meant a loss of wages to the workers of and of trade to the manufacturers wholesalers and retail merchants who depend on this industry of more everyone who buys a ready made garment will now have to pay his share of this bill of expense but he will have the he satisfaction of knowing that the conditions of labor for the poor workers have been made better under the terms of settlement of the strike what is known as the sweatshops are to be abolished that is the workers will not be allowed to take their work to their homes which are nearl nearly y always unsanitary but will have to work in factories where the conditions hours of labor etc can be watched ched and regulated the agreed to ga gw union tinion men the preference for employment and to do what they could to get all employees to join the union they belie veIn labor unions they say but not in in strike violence or other interference with individual liberty during the past week the people of this valley have witnessed a cerise sense of ra rainbow displays as has ever been seen by
